The first new england mills where all
egoroff_w [7]

Answer:

Cotton Textile Mills

Explanation:

The first new England mills were all textile-based. The first mills were first introduced by the Boston merchants in the town of Lowell, Massachusetts. The textile factory in Lowell's workers were young women. The Lowell Mills hired younger girls along with single women in factories from New England farms. Many girls left their house from rural areas to join mills in cities to earn their living and support their families.
